Legionnaires’ disease is a severe form of pneumonia caused by the Legionella bacteria This potentially fatal disease can be contracted by inhaling water droplets or vapors contaminated with the bacteria While Legionella can be found in many different water sources, one common source of Legionnaires’ disease outbreaks is hot water heaters.
Hot water heaters provide the perfect environment for Legionella bacteria to thrive The warm temperature of the water, typically between 95-115 degrees Fahrenheit, and the sediments that can accumulate in the tank create an ideal breeding ground for the bacteria Additionally, if the water heater is not properly maintained or cleaned regularly, the risk of Legionella growth increases significantly.
When Legionella bacteria proliferate in a hot water heater, they can be released into the air through the hot water system This aerosolized water can then be inhaled by individuals in the vicinity, putting them at risk of contracting Legionnaires’ disease Symptoms of the disease can range from mild flu-like symptoms to severe pneumonia, making it crucial to address the root cause of the contamination.
One of the main ways to prevent Legionnaires’ disease outbreaks linked to hot water heaters is through proper maintenance and cleaning Regular flushing of the water heater can help remove any sediments that could harbor Legionella bacteria Cleaning and disinfecting the tank and pipes with the appropriate chemicals can also help eliminate any existing bacteria colonies.
Additionally, maintaining the water heater at a temperature of at least 140 degrees Fahrenheit can help prevent Legionella growth This temperature is hot enough to kill the bacteria but still safe for use in household appliances However, caution should be taken to avoid scalding, especially in homes with young children or elderly individuals.

In commercial settings such as hospitals, hotels, and nursing homes, where the risk of Legionnaires’ disease outbreaks is higher, additional precautions may be necessary Regular monitoring of water quality, implementing a water safety plan, and training staff on Legionella prevention protocols are essential steps to mitigate the risk of an outbreak.
